What to expect: 

The Breakfast Club is a new program for Canmore Pride. This is a space for grassroots community skill sharing. Each month will focus on a different skill / craft!

This month’s skill share is: TBD

Supplies provided. Light breakfast + refreshments provided.

———

Who can come?

This space is for 2SLGBTQIA+ people and allies. Recommended for ages 16+. No sign-up is required.

This is by donation at the door (optional).

———

I have a skill I’d like to share! How do I sign up?

We welcome all ideas and all levels! You do not need to be an expert to sign up. Each workshop has a supplies budget of ~$75. Please use this form to submit your idea: https://forms.gle/pPg3FzAPS5tJCXKo9

Allies are also welcome to sign up to lead a skill share workshop.

We recommend sharing a skill that can be taught within the 2-hour window.

Example: making zines, polymer clay magnets, darning socks, potting plants, etc.
